Denise WoodsMost recently, Denise served as the dialect coach for the Disney film, Step Up 3D directed by John Chu. She is currently the dialect coach for Broadway’s critically acclaimed Porgy & Bess starring Audra McDonald and David Allen Grier.

Some of her clients include Soledad O’Brien, Chris Hansen, Maria Bartiromo, Norah O’Donnell, Kim Rouggie, Rachel Boesing and Zorrianna Kit. As a dialect coach for actors in the film industry, her work includes Academy-Award nominated actors Ken Watanabe in The Last Samurai directed by Ed Zwick and Will Smith in Ali directed by Michael Mann. Other films include Shaft starring Jeffrey Wright, Last Holiday starring Queen Latifah, How Stella Got Her Groove Back starring Taye Diggs and Once in the Life written, starring and directed by Laurence Fishburne.

Some of the most rewarding experiences have been those with Phylicia Rashad, Ellen Burstyn, Morris Chestnut, Sanaa Lathan, Paul Rodriguez, Victoria Rowell, Eve, Ray Liotta, Porscia DeRossi, Rachel Weisz, Mekhi Phifer, Maggie Gyllenhaal, Jeanne Trupplehorn and Mike Myers.

Denise is using her expertise to help professional athletes improve their communication and media skills. She has worked with some of sports most popular athletes including players from the New York Knicks and the New York Giants as well as several retired ath-letes looking to further their careers in broadcasting and business.

As a graduate of The Juilliard School, she became the first African-American female to join the Drama Division faculty in 1992. To date, Woods’ most rewarding achievement has been the creation of “Express Yourself,” a program she founded in 1996 teaching voice, speech and acting to teenagers from the Harlem community.
